Reynolds winning pitcher for PECI
Morgan Reynolds was winning pitcher as PECI defeated Centennial Secondary School 6-5 Friday night. Coach Matt Ronan notes the game featured strong hitting by Sean Simpson, Joey Davies and Reynolds. Pitch, Hit and Run Tuesday
Pitch Hit and Run rescheduled, due to weather, to Tuesday, May 11 4:30 – 6 p.m. at the Wellington ball diamonds. County Baseball has converted the old “Wellington A” Diamond into a little league baseball diamond with a grass infield, clay baselines and a raised pitcher’s mound. No more sliding into road gravel!
